In the turmoil of World War II, Polish sisters Helena and Luzyna Grabowski lose everything and are sent to a refugee camp in Persia. When relocation to New Zealand offers a glimmer of hope, circumstances force Helena to leave Luzyna behind, leading to a journey filled with guilt and trauma. As Helena tries to rebuild her life in New Zealand, haunted by her past, she struggles to embrace new relationships, including that of James, a charming Allied pilot. Ultimately, she must confront her fears and learn to hope again for a brighter future.
